Pacifica is presently under the leadership of a court-ordered Interim
Pacifica National Board, following an intense and successful struggle to
overthrow the previous Pacifica National Board. Under its new bylaws,
Pacifica will be totally controlled by its members, with one vote per
member. Anyone who joins a local Pacifica radio station automatically
becomes a member of The Pacifica Foundation. All Pacifica stations are
also broadcast on the Internet, so listening is not limited only to those
who live in the five local areas. Elections are now underway for Pacifica
members to select Delegates to each of the five Local Station Boards,
which will ultimately control the Pacifica National Board, and thus
Pacifica Radio.
